Creamy Ground Beef and Vegetable Soup

This Creamy Ground Beef and Vegetable Soup is a hearty, comforting dish combining savory ground beef, fresh vegetables, and a creamy broth. It’s a perfect meal for cold days or anytime you need a warm, nutritious bowl.

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 2 carrots, diced
  • 2 celery stalks, diced
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 2 medium potatoes, cubed
  • 1 cup corn kernels
  • 1 cup green beans, chopped
  • 6 cups beef bro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ream or half-and-half
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(optional)

Instructions

  1. In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add ground beef and cook until browned. Drain excess fat.
  2. Add onion, garlic, carrots, and celery. Cook until softened.
  3. Stir in potatoes, corn, and green beans. Pour in beef broth and bring to a boil.
  4. Reduce heat and simmer until vegetables are tender, about 20 minutes.
  5. Slowly stir in heavy cream and season with salt and pepper. Heat gently without boiling.
  6.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.

Notes

  • Substitute ground turkey or chicken for a lighter version.
  • Add other vegetables like peas, zucchini, or spinach.
  • Use half-and-half or milk instead of heavy cream for a lighter soup.
  • Spice it up with a pinch of cayenne or smoked paprika.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• Reheat gently on the stove or microwave, stirring occasionally. Avoid boiling after adding cream.
